AZTEC ECONOMY is a Brooklyn-based non-profit arts collective initiated in Spring 2008 to present new live performances for the public. Our work seeks to provide a fresh perspective on American culture and its relationship to ritual, mythology, madness, dreams, and deliverance. AE‘s projects have been featured in NYC at the Obie Award Winning Ice Factory, the Ohio Theater in Soho, The New Ohio in the West Village, IRT, 3 Legged Dog in Lower Manhattan, I.R.T., The Tank in Tribeca & Times Square, Dixon Place in the Lower East Side, P.S.122 in the East Village, Monkey Town & The Brick Theater & Big Sky Works & House of Yes & Silent Barn & Bird River Studios, Brooklyn Fireproof, Bushwick Open Studios, Bushwick Starr, Greenpoint’s Lutheran Church of the Messiah, West Park Presbyterian Church; at the New Orleans Fringe Festival: Mudlark Puppet Theatre & The Purification Plant, the Fridge in D.C., Collaboraction in Chicago, on board the Historic Steamship Lilac off the Hudson River, The Gladys City Spindletop Boomtown Grounds & BCP in Beaumont-Texas, EMP Collective in Baltimore, Columbia Festival of the Arts in Maryland, WaterTower Theatre in Dallas, Silver Meteor & HCC College in Tampa, West Palm Organics in Florida, Know Theatre / The Cincinnati Fringe Festival, Tricklock Revolutions & University of New Mexico in Albuquerque, and bars, rooftops, churches, and backyards all over Brooklyn.

THEATRE SYNESTHESIA was born in 2012 and seeks to engage its community with provocative performance, inspire its audience with bold, new and contemporary stories, and foster the growth and development of young theatre artists in central Texas. We seek to create and develop exciting and lasting relationships with our community and audience, provide high quality, thought provoking productions, and promote new, exciting voices in American theatre, and d. create and sustain an inclusive and enjoyable presence in central Texas.
